Uptechunt

Hire Freelance Expert Systems Developers

The development of different systems and ensuring that they are working excellently are all possible with the help of Expert System Developers. Here at UpTecHunt, we assure you that the systems developers here are highly educated and will match your needs. Hire one now!

Hire Freelancer

Key Skills to Look, Before Hire Freelance Expert Systems Developers.

Given the help they provide, expert systems developers are in great demand these days. Before hiring one, you should take into account a few essential skills, which are as follows:

Skills to Consider for Expert Systems Developers:

  • Understanding of Software Engineering Principles

Understanding of the based approach to system development is fundamental. Thus, in order to guarantee that the software systems are resilient and credible, Expert Systems Developers need to be familiar with these ideas.

  • Programming Ability

In order to write, read, and debug programs in programming languages like Python, Java, and SQL, expert systems developers need to be familiar with the syntax, techniques, and structures of coding. 

  • Data analysis

Expert Systems Developers need to be adept at organizing and analyzing vast amounts of data in order to meet end-user expectations and choose the best computer system.

  • Teamwork and Communication

Collaborating with others is crucial, and it will have a direct effect on how information is used to make sure that everyone is on the same page regarding the project's objective.

  • Ability to solve problems

The Expert Systems Developers must possess the analytical and technical skills necessary to solve the brand-new issues that may arise throughout the project.


Roles and Responsibilities of Expert Systems Developers?

Expert Systems Developers are required to do a variety of roles and responsibilities. They include the following:

Roles and Responsibilities of Expert Systems Developers:

  • Make sure that the systems are functional and functioning properly by running several tests on them.
  • Provide end users with technical support for any system problems, particularly if there are unclear solutions.
  • Encourage backups of the organization's data records.
  • Ensure that the system runs continuously by identifying and resolving any software issues.
  • Create API libraries, data processes, and data structures for the system's operations.


What are the Interview questions for Expert Systems Developers?

Before hiring an applicant for your project, you should interview possible expert systems developers to learn more about their qualifications. As a result, you can utilize the interview questions listed below: 

Interview Questions for Expert Systems Developers: 

  • Describe your career as a system developer.

Asking this question at the beginning of the interview will help you get to know the system developer and learn a little bit about their background and length of employment.

  • Which of your previous projects have been successful?

You can get a sense of the system developer's past projects and their duration by asking this question.

  • How do you ensure that the software on the system is safe from threats?

By posing this question, you can evaluate the system developer's dependability in creating virus-free systems that operate smoothly for end users.

  • Describe the process you use to improve a system's performance.

The system developer can demonstrate their proficiency in evaluating software performance and how they have improved it by answering this question.

  • Talk about your programming language experience.

Asking this question will help you make sure the system developer is knowledgeable about program principles.

 

How to Hire the Best Freelance Expert Systems Developers?

The following preferences will assist you in selecting the best freelance expert systems developers for your project:

Techniques for Selecting the Best Freelance Expert Systems Developers:  

  • Establish requirements:
  • List the qualifications you expect the expert system developer to possess. This could contain their education, background, and credentials, in addition to samples of their prior work from other projects.
  • Conduct interviews: Interviewing possible applicants is an important phase that you should not skip. This provides you with an additional opportunity to assess the applicant's degree of expertise and discover more about them, including the nature of their previous employment and employer.
  • Acquire references: It's important to assess the applicant's credibility, so you can use references from their previous undertakings to confirm the facts they've provided.
  • Compensation Rate: Since expert systems developers have different rates, it's best to talk to them about the terms of payment. If that's the case, be sure they won't jeopardize the project's or the system developer's value before taking their own costs.



What Challenges will you face when hiring Expert Systems Developers?

While hiring freelance expert systems developers, there are a number of challenges to overcome; a few of these are outlined below.

Difficulties in Hiring Expert Systems Developers:

  • Insufficient Expert Systems Developers: The current shortage of these individuals may be one of the reasons you are having trouble finding one for your project.
  • Expert Systems Developers' Accessibility: Even if you are privileged in finding one, there's a chance that their timetable won't work for your project.
  • Absence of expertise and experience: If you're looking for expert system developers with experience, you may not have found any because some system developers might not have the skills up to the task.
  • Exceptional Pay Rate: Although system developers are allowed to choose their own fees, some may undervalue your project or charge more than they are capable of charging.

Notwithstanding these challenges, UpTecHunt promises a simple and engaging hiring process for you. Considering that every expert systems developers working in this industry is skilled and well-versed in their expertise.

 

How do you negotiate rates and terms with your freelance Expert Systems Developers?

The terms of payment for any freelancer are quite important, and you can both gain from establishing an appropriate payment plan together. So, to assist you in negotiating with our freelance expert systems developers, we have provided you with the following guidelines:

Negotiation Tips for Freelance Expert Systems Developers: 

  • Determine the project's value: You must ascertain the project's value beforehand so that they can have an understanding of it. In order to avoid misunderstandings, include the project's timeframe as well.
  • Describe the freelancer's payment schedule: You have a few options for paying the freelancer, and it might also depend on how they choose to be paid, such as a fixed project or a number of hours worked.
  • Offer Payment Contract: To safeguard the freelancer and the project, it is best to draft a contract with clear terms and conditions.
  • Be open to recommendations and offers: If a freelancer gives you a rate, consider it and be prepared to accept. Before accepting it, think about how accepting it would affect the freelancer's experience and the project's value.

Frequently Asked Questions

Find quick answers to the most common questions about using UpTecHunt. Whether you’re a freelancer looking for opportunities or a client ready to hire, this section helps you get started with confidence.

Why Choose UpTecHunt?

UpTecHunt makes hiring simple and reliable by connecting clients with verified freelancers through a secure, transparent, and user-friendly platform. With expert talent, fair pricing, and dedicated support, we help every project succeed — every time.

Connect with pre-vetted, top-tier freelancers chosen for skill, reliability, and proven results. Get quality work you can trust — every project, every time.

Hello
Hello
Hello

How It Works — Simple, Secure, and Transparent

Whether you’re hiring or freelancing, UpTecHunt makes collaboration simple, fast, and secure. Follow these easy steps to get started.

Step 1: Create Your Profile

Showcase your skills, experience, and portfolio to attract trusted clients. A complete profile builds credibility and increases your chance of getting hired.

Step 2: Browse Jobs That Match You

Explore verified projects from global clients — no bidding stress, no wasted time. Find real opportunities that match your skills and goals.

Step 3: Send Proposals with Confidence

Apply to projects with tailored proposals and stay informed when clients view your application — no uncertainty, just clear communication.

Step 4: Deliver Work, Stress-Free

Collaborate through your dashboard, share files securely, and track milestones in one place — built for smooth project delivery.

Step 5: Get Paid Instantly via Wallet Security

Complete your project and receive payments instantly through our wallet-secured system. No delays, no worries — just reliable transactions.

Item-0
Item-1
Item-2
Item-3
Item-4

Find the Perfect Freelancer for Your Project

Don't wait to bring your vision to life. Connect with skilled freelancers who can craft impactful solutions tailored to your business needs. Post a job now and hire the perfect freelancer in minutes!

Best Freelance Expert Systems Developers in state USA

Top Expert Systems Developers in AlabamaTop Expert Systems Developers in AlaskaBest Expert Systems Developers in ArizonaTop Expert Systems Developers in ArkansasBest Expert Systems Developers in CaliforniaTop Expert Systems Developers in ColoradoBest Expert Systems Developers in ConnecticutTop Expert Systems Developers in DelawareTop Expert Systems Developers in FloridaTop Expert Systems Developers in GeorgiaTop Expert Systems Developers in HawaiiBest Expert Systems Developers in IdahoTop Expert Systems Developers in IllinoisBest Expert Systems Developers in IndianaTop Expert Systems Developers in IowaTop Expert Systems Developers in KansasBest Expert Systems Developers in KentuckyTop Expert Systems Developers in LouisianaTop Expert Systems Developers in MaineTop Expert Systems Developers in MassachusettsBest Expert Systems Developers in MichiganBest Expert Systems Developers in MississippiTop Expert Systems Developers in MissouriTop Expert Systems Developers in NebraskaTop Expert Systems Developers in NevadaBest Expert Systems Developers in New-HampshireTop Expert Systems Developers in New-JerseyBest Expert Systems Developers in New-MexicoTop Expert Systems Developers in New-YorkBest Expert Systems Developers in North-CarolinaTop Expert Systems Developers in North-DakotaTop Expert Systems Developers in OhioTop Expert Systems Developers in OregonTop Expert Systems Developers in PennsylvaniaBest Expert Systems Developers in Rhode-IslandTop Expert Systems Developers in South-DakotaBest Expert Systems Developers in TennesseeTop Expert Systems Developers in TexasTop Expert Systems Developers in UtahBest Expert Systems Developers in VermontBest Expert Systems Developers in WashingtonTop Expert Systems Developers in West-VirginiaBest Expert Systems Developers in WisconsinTop Expert Systems Developers in WyomingBest Expert Systems Developers in MarylandTop Expert Systems Developers in VirginiaTop Expert Systems Developers in South-CarolinaBest Expert Systems Developers in OklahomaBest Expert Systems Developers in MontanaTop Expert Systems Developers in Minnesota